Transaction 5121f61c34acd4a4601bc6844378eaead717935ed09cff9cc53b5d7cf138be98
1 Input
2 Outputs
- 5121f61c34acd4a4601bc6844378eaead717935ed09cff9cc53b5d7cf138be98:0
- 5121f61c34acd4a4601bc6844378eaead717935ed09cff9cc53b5d7cf138be98:1
value 32803
address 1EbqcLySm2CvJWo3fV9aYG9C8rLaYr5buN
value 9577440
address 1EZkoULbahsg9LAmgzaQQyT4QqwHvmphoS